Using the Remote Control

Press any one of the COMPUTER 1/2, COMPONENT, VIDEO,
S-VIDEO or VIEWER buttons.

Selecting from Source List

Press and quickly release the SOURCE button on the projec-
tor cabinet to display the Source list. Each time the SOURCE
button is pressed, the input source will change as follows:
"Computer 1/2", "Component" (DVD player), "Video" (VCR or
laser disc player), “S-Video" or "Viewer" (slides on a PC card).
To display the selected source, press the ENTER button.

Detecting the Signal Automatically

Press and hold the SOURCE button for a minimum of 1 sec-
ond, the projector will search for the next available input
source. Each time you press and hold the SOURCE button
for a minimum of 1 second, the input source will change as
follows:

Computer1

→ Computer2 → Component → Video → S-Video

→ Viewer → Computer1 → ...

If no input signal is present, the input will be skipped. When
the input source you wish to project is displayed, release the
button.
